#c1c9e2 basic color information

#c1c9e2

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#c1c9e2 has decimal index of: 12700130, is composed of 75.7% red, 78.8% green and 88.6% blue. #c1c9e2 in CMYK color model, is composed of 14.6% cyan, 11.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 11.4% black.
#cccccc is the closest web-safe color to #c1c9e2.

Analogous colors

They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.

Monochromatic

Shades are created by decreasing luminance in HSL color model, and tints by increasing it. The next step for shades is #000 and for tints is #fff.
